Responsibilities for Quality Technician:
- Adhere to all health and safety policies, Good Manufacturing Practices (GMPs), and wear required personal protective equipment (PPE) in the warehouse and production areas
- Prepare production equipment for cleaning and follow lockout/tagout procedures as required
- Use cleaning chemicals as per label instructions and safety guidelines
- Sanitize and clean production equipment (e.g., containers, rinsers, warmers, pasteurizers)
- Clean and sanitize conveyors, conveying equipment, drip pans, rails, floors, drains, and ceilings in production and warehouse areas.
- Perform general cleaning of the facility, including bathrooms, trash cans, office areas, and parking lots
- Verify sanitation effectiveness through visual inspection and chemical concentration testing
- Maintain accurate sanitation documentation and ensure completion of the Master Sanitation Schedule
- Ensure minimal downtime during sanitation and pre-operational inspections
